Non-teaching staff compensation as a percentage of total expenditure in Andorra
Andorra: Non-teaching staff compensation as a percentage of total expenditure was 14.7% in 2011. ◆ Volatile
Non-teaching staff compensation as a percentage of total expenditure in Andorra, 2002–2011
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Andorra recorded 14.7% for non-teaching staff compensation as a percentage of total expenditure in 2011.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.
The figure is up 194.1% over five years.
Over the whole period, non-teaching staff compensation as a percentage of total expenditure in Andorra peaked at 14.7% in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2002.
Andorra ranks 36th of 61 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
